If it was an STI Version 2 then itd be on an N registration at the very earliest. They were manufactured from September-October time in 1995, for the 1996 modle year. There wasnt a 'Version 1' though: they converted WRX Saloons and 'Wagons in 1994 and WRX Type-RAs in 1995. Both of these altered production cars retained their original model applied model numbers, so they wont help.

Its unlikely that an M registered car is an STI, but a quick look under the bonnet will reveal a Subaru Technica International plaque, with either an 'of 100' (with mention of the Acropolis Rally) or an 'of 200' number.

If it doesnt have this, then it isnt an STI; no matter what the vendor tells you.

One further point: if its white, has a roof vent and DCCD, then itll be a 1995 WRX STI Type-RA. This could be registered on an 'M', but its provenance is a little easier to establish, so I doubt that youd be asking.....
